As savvy investors will confirm, Russia is one of the business world’s best-kept secrets. While developed markets fail to generate much beyond low single-digit growth, the Russian market offers tremendous opportunity for growth. Despite a slowdown forecast for 2009, Russia’s economy is expected to bounce back in 2010, driven mainly by the energy sector.

Inside Russia is the ideal bridge for companies interested in doing business in Russia. Under the guidance of IESE Professors Pedro Videla and Evgeny Káganer, and The Economist Group's Senior Vice President Daniel Thorniley, the program provides insights on the economic, political and social environment as well as long-term investment opportunities and consumer behavior.
Dynamic sessions in Moscow and St. Petersburg and networking opportunities with Russian business leaders
will offer a close-up view of doing business in Russia today. Ultimately, participants will leave the program convinced that free market competition is the rule rather than the exception.
